To detect noisy plumbing, it is necessary to figure out first whether the undesirable sounds happen on the system's inlet side-in other words, when water is transformed on-or on the drain side. Sounds on the inlet side have differed causes: too much water stress, used valve and also faucet components, improperly linked pumps or various other home appliances, inaccurately put pipeline fasteners, and plumbing runs having too many tight bends or various other constraints. Noises on the drain side generally stem from poor place or, similar to some inlet side sound, a design containing limited bends.
Hissing
Hissing sound that occurs when a tap is opened a little typically signals extreme water pressure. Consult your regional public utility if you suspect this issue; it will certainly have the ability to tell you the water stress in your location and can set up a pressurereducing shutoff on the inbound supply of water pipeline if required.
Various Other Inlet Side Noises
Creaking, squeaking, scraping, breaking, and also touching generally are caused by the expansion or contraction of pipes, typically copper ones providing warm water. The noises take place as the pipelines slide versus loosened bolts or strike neighboring residence framework. You can often pinpoint the location of the trouble if the pipelines are exposed; just comply with the noise when the pipes are making noise. Probably you will find a loose pipe hanger or an area where pipes lie so close to flooring joists or various other mounting items that they clatter versus them. Affixing foam pipeline insulation around the pipelines at the point of get in touch with must correct the trouble. Make certain bands as well as hangers are protected and provide adequate assistance. Where feasible, pipeline bolts ought to be attached to huge structural components such as structure wall surfaces rather than to framing; doing so lessens the transmission of resonances from plumbing to surface areas that can magnify as well as move them. If attaching bolts to framework is inevitable, wrap pipes with insulation or various other durable material where they contact bolts, and also sandwich the ends of new bolts in between rubber washers when installing them.
Correcting plumbing runs that deal with flow-restricting limited or various bends is a last resort that needs to be embarked on only after consulting a skilled plumbing professional. Regrettably, this situation is rather typical in older houses that might not have actually been built with interior plumbing or that have seen several remodels, particularly by amateurs.
Babbling or Shrieking
Intense chattering or shrilling that occurs when a shutoff or faucet is activated, which usually goes away when the fitting is opened totally, signals loose or malfunctioning internal parts. The option is to replace the shutoff or faucet with a brand-new one.
Pumps and devices such as washing equipments as well as dish washers can transfer electric motor noise to pipelines if they are improperly attached. Link such things to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Drain Noise
On the drainpipe side of plumbing, the principal objectives are to get rid of surface areas that can be struck by falling or rushing water and also to insulate pipelines to contain unavoidable noises.
In new building and construction, bathtubs, shower stalls, commodes, as well as wallmounted sinks and also basins need to be set on or against resistant underlayments to minimize the transmission of sound with them. Water-saving commodes as well as taps are less noisy than conventional versions; install them as opposed to older types even if codes in your location still allow utilizing older components.
Drainpipes that do not run up and down to the basement or that branch right into horizontal pipe runs sustained at floor joists or various other framing present specifically problematic sound problems. Such pipelines are big sufficient to radiate significant resonance; they additionally carry considerable quantities of water, which makes the scenario even worse. In new building, define cast-iron soil pipes (the huge pipes that drain commodes) if you can manage them. Their massiveness consists of a lot of the sound made by water passing through them. Likewise, stay clear of routing drainpipes in wall surfaces shown to bedrooms and also rooms where people collect. Wall surfaces including drainpipes need to be soundproofed as was described earlier, utilizing dual panels of sound-insulating fiber board and wallboard. Pipes themselves can be covered with unique fiberglass insulation created the purpose; such pipes have an impervious vinyl skin (in some cases including lead). Outcomes are not constantly satisfactory.
Thudding
Thudding noise, typically accompanied by shivering pipes, when a faucet or home appliance shutoff is switched off is a problem called water hammer. The sound and vibration are caused by the reverberating wave of pressure in the water, which unexpectedly has no location to go. Often opening up a valve that discharges water swiftly right into an area of piping having a constraint, joint, or tee installation can create the exact same problem.
Water hammer can normally be treated by setting up installations called air chambers or shock absorbers in the plumbing to which the trouble shutoffs or taps are linked. These gadgets enable the shock wave produced by the halted circulation of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ems may have brief upright areas of capped pipeline behind wall surfaces on tap competes the exact same purpose; these can eventually fill with water, lowering or damaging their performance. The treatment is to drain pipes the water supply totally by turning off the main water supply valve and also opening up all faucets. Then open up the primary supply valve as well as close the taps one by one, starting with the tap nearest the shutoff as well as finishing with the one farthest away.
3 Most Common Reasons for Noisy Water Pipes
Water hammer
When water is running and is then suddenly turned off, the rushing liquid has no place to go and slams against the shut-off valve. The loud, thudding sound that follows is known as a water hammer. Besides being alarming, water hammer can potentially damage joints and connections in the water pipe itself. There are two primary methods of addressing this issue.
Check your air chamber. An air chamber is essentially a vertical pipe located near your faucet, often in the wall cavity that holds the plumbing connected to your sink or tub. The chamber is filled with air that compresses and absorbs the shock of the fast moving water when it suddenly stops. Unfortunately, over time air chambers tend to fill with water and lose their effectiveness. To replenish the air chambers in your house you can do the following. Turn off the water supply to your house at the main supply (or street level). Open your faucets to drain all of the water from your plumbing system. Turn the water back on. The incoming water will flush the air out of the pipes but not out of the vertical air chamber, where the air supply has been restored. Copper pipes
Copper pipes tend to expand as hot water passes through and transfers some of its heat to them. (Copper is both malleable and ductile.) In tight quarters, copper hot-water lines can expand and then noisily rub against your home's hidden structural features — studs, joists, support brackets, etc. — as it contracts.
One possible solution to this problem is to slightly lower the temperature setting on your hot water heater. In all but the most extreme cases, expanding and contracting copper pipes will not spring a leak. Unless you’re remodeling, there's no reason to remove sheetrock and insert foam padding around your copper pipes.
Water pressure that’s too high
If your water pressure is too high, it can also cause noisy water pipes. Worse, high water pressure can damage water-supplied appliances, such as your washing machine and dishwasher.
Most modern homes are equipped with a pressure regulator that's mounted where the water supply enters the house. If your home lacks a regulator, consider having one professionally installed. Finally, remember that most plumbers recommend that water is delivered throughout your home at no lower than 40 and no greater than 80 psi (pounds per square inch).
